Water Resistance Ratings

Among the important features to consider in Caterpillar watches is their water resistance ratings. These ratings indicate how well your watch can handle moisture, making them vital for outdoor activities or everyday wear. When you're selecting a Caterpillar watch, look for models with ratings of at least 50 meters (5 ATM), which are appropriate for swimming and snorkeling. For avid divers, a rating of 100 meters (10 ATM) or more is preferable. Remember, a higher rating often means superior protection against water damage. Always check the specifications to ensure the watch meets your lifestyle needs. With the right water resistance, you won't have to worry about removing your watch during daily tasks or adventures.

Regular Maintenance Techniques

Standard cleaning practices can maintain your Caterpillar watch staying sharp and functioning smoothly. To kick things off, delicately clean the watch case and bracelet with a lint-free, soft cloth to remove dust and fingerprints. For stubborn dirt, use a damp cloth with a mild soap solution, ensuring you never soak the watch. Refrain from using harsh chemicals that could damage the finish.

When dealing with a rubber strap watch, apply warm soapy water and a soft brush for cleaning, then rinse well. Always verify the seals and buttons for dirt deposits, since this could influence proper operation. Last but not least, the crystal needs attention too; use a microfiber cloth to wipe it gently for a scratch-free, clear finish. Regular maintenance ensures longevity and keeps your watch looking brand new.

Correct Storage Options

Although you may be inclined to throw your Caterpillar watch into a drawer, appropriate storage is essential for preserving its state and durability. Start by using a dedicated watch box or organizer to preserve your timepiece shielded from damage and debris. Prevent exposing it to drastic temperature changes or humidity levels, as these can damage the internal mechanisms. If your watch has a leather strap, ensure it stays away from direct sunlight to avert associated article fading or breaking. Always keep your timepiece in a place where it won't experience impacts; a cushioned slot is ideal. Finally, if you aren't planning to use it for an extended period, contemplate extracting the battery or winding it regularly to maintain it in peak operating status.

Battery Maintenance Tips

After ensuring your Caterpillar watch is stored appropriately, battery maintenance becomes the next priority for keeping it in top shape. Monitor regularly your watch's battery life; a low battery can influence timekeeping. If your watch has a quartz movement, think about replacing the battery every two to three years. When changing the battery, always use the correct type to prevent damage. Keep an eye out for moisture or condensation; this can suggest a battery problem or a potential leak. If you detect any evidence of corrosion, take it for service immediately. Finally, avoid exposing your watch to extreme temperatures, as this can decrease battery life. By following these tips, you'll guarantee your Caterpillar watch remains both functional and stylish for years to come.
